Abstract
Abstract This paper presents the shaking table test results of a scaled steel gable frame subjected to earthquake ground motions of different intensities. The strain mode shape (SMS) calculated from dynamic strain gage data is used as the primary indicator to identify damaged locations of the structure due to inelastic deformation. Observations show the change of SMS to be the greatest around the damaged area. Also observed is the ��recovering SMS�� during an inelastic time history response. Methodology used in this analysis may help engineers foster the idea of structural diagnosis through vibration monitoring.
